Description
This deceptively spacious and beautifully designed ground floor apartment combines comfort, convenience, and privacy within a secure gated enclave. Built in 2001, the accommodation includes a generous open-plan kitchen, living, and dining area, with two sets of French doors opening directly onto a private brick-paved patio and the well-maintained communal gardens. Both double bedrooms are ensuite, offering comfort and practicality. The development features secure walled-in parking, with electric vehicular and pedestrian gates, while an intercom system inside the apartment provides convenient access control. The communal gardens are attractively landscaped with mature trees, colourful shrubs, and seasonal flowers, creating a peaceful outdoor setting. Ideally located, the apartment is just a two-minute walk from the Dublin Road bus stop, ensuring excellent transport links and making it an ideal choice for both homeowners and investors.

About the Area
Trim (Irish: Baile Átha Troim) is situated on the River Boyne, and has a population of approximately 9,000. This charming, well planned town attracts a large number of visitors and has now developed a reputation as being the gourmet capital of the North East. The town has a host of excellent hotels including Knightsbrook, Trim Castle and Castle Arch and has now established itself as a go-to location for dining out with a number of first class restaurants. The town is noted for Trim Castle - the largest Anglo-Norman castle in Ireland. Trim has won the prestigious Irish Tidy Towns Competition several times, including a Gold Medal in 2014, highlighting the strong sense of community. There is a regular bus service to Blanchardstown and Dublin City. Trim has excellent schools including five primary and two secondary schools.
